Evaluating relocation options in Cumberland? The financial benchmark for residing in Mount Holly Springs, PA (17065) indicates that a single worker needs roughly $2,961 monthly ($35,528.171 annually) to maintain an adequate standard of living.
With typical rent and housing utilities averaging an affordable $675 per month—just 23% of baseline expenses—Mount Holly Springs offers exceptionally competitive housing costs compared to wider metropolitan averages across Pennsylvania.
Local earnings in Mount Holly Springs (17065) demonstrate strong purchasing power. The area median family income of $91,474 significantly exceeds the annual baseline living threshold ($35,528.171) by a ratio of 2.57x. This economic buffer allows local households to comfortably absorb inflationary spikes and build long-term wealth.
Tax obligations represent roughly 15% ($454/month) of baseline monthly spending in zip code 17065. State and federal tax obligations form a consistent component of monthly financial planning. Meanwhile, essential groceries average $289 monthly for single adults.
